Data Strategy: Develop a comprehensive data strategy that aligns with our hospital's mission, vision, and strategic plan. Build, lead, and inspire a team of data engineers, data scientists, and BI developers.
Data Engineering: Oversee the development of a modern data architecture that includes data ingestion, data processing, and data storage. This will involve developing a robust data pipeline, implementing ETL processes, and ensuring data quality and integrity. Develop, manage, allocate and drive fiscal responsibility of the annual budget for the data and analytics Engineering departments.
Self-Service Platforms: Implement Self-Service platforms that enable hospital staff, and research departments to access and analyze data for real-time decision-making. This includes working closely with hospital departments to understand their data needs and working with product teams to build tools.
Advanced Analytics: Lead efforts to utilize AI and ML to uncover insights from our data and make predictive recommendations. This could include developing models to predict patient outcomes, optimize hospital operations, process streaming data, and identify trends and patterns in patient health.
Security & Compliance: Ensure all data operations adhere to privacy, security, and compliance standards such as HIPAA and other relevant regulations.
Stakeholder Management: Communicate effectively with data and analytics leaders and staff, patients, and other stakeholders about data initiatives. This includes translating complex data concepts into understandable insights and recommendations.
Architecture: Lead the development, publishing and maintenance of the organization’s information architecture, as well as a roadmap for its future development, ensuring that it aligns and supports business needs
Data Platform Management: Oversee the development and deployment of the enterprise’s data and analytics platform(s) to achieve the enterprise vision and goals including the integration and staging of data, and the development and maintenance of the data lakes, data warehouse, data marts, for use by analysts throughout the organization. Expand the enterprise’s offerings, especially in emerging analytical approaches, skills and technologies.

General Summary:
The Senior Director of Data Engineering & Advanced Analytics will play a pivotal role in leading the data and analytics transformation at Lurie Children’s Hospital, focusing on leveraging data to drive insights, decision-making, research platforms and improving patient outcomes. Successful candidate will have a strong background in modern data engineering, cloud-based Business Intelligence (BI) self-service platforms, and Advanced Analytics using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ML).
The Senior Director of Data Engineering & Advanced Analytics executes on deploying enterprise-wide solutions on a modern data stack designed for complex data challenges, including developing and applying algorithmic models to derive insights, improve decision making, and automate processes. The Senior Director of Data Engineering will manage Engineering, BI and Advanced Analytics resources and lead in the planning, evaluating, and selecting the right modern data platform capabilities, deploy self-service analytics for Lurie citizen data explorers and help distributed analytics staff to have industry aligned D&A skills, processes, and technologies.

Ann & Robert H. Lurie Children's Hospital of Chicago, formerly Children's Memorial Hospital and commonly known as Lurie Children's, is a nationally ranked pediatric acute care children's hospital located in Chicago, Illinois.
